This experimental study with a controlled pre-test and post-test group design investigated the possible effects of four sessions of heading training on cognitive performance. A total of 118 participants (mean age of 22.25 years) were assigned to one of the three following groups: a heading-training group, a passing-training group and a waiting control group. The participants completed a cognitive test battery of attention (D2-test), working memory (Paced Auditory Serial Addition Task, PASAT-2) and visual spatial intelligence (Mental Rotation Test) tests before, immediately after the second training session and one week after the fourth training session. There were no between-group differences in cognitive performance after the second or the fourth heading training sessions. However, within the heading-training group, women complained more of headaches than men after the fourth training session. These results build on the results from the study of Rieder and Jansen (2011) that showed no neuropsychological consequences after one heading session, showing no cumulative effects of repeat heading.

Abstract Background Hypoxic conditioning has been proposed as a new tool to mitigate the sarcopenia and enhance health-related function, but decrements in standing balance have been observed during hypoxia exposure. The aim of the study was to evaluate the effect of a hypoxic conditioning training on functional fitness, balance and fear of falling in healthy older adults. Methods A total of 54 healthy older adults (aged 65–75 years), who voluntarily participated in the study, were randomly divided into three groups: the control group (CON), the normoxia training group (NT) that performed strength training in normoxia, and the hypoxia training group (HT) that trained under moderate hypoxic conditions at a simulated altitude of 2500 m asl. The training programme that was performed during 24 weeks was similar in both experimental groups and consisted of a full-body workout with elastic bands and kettlebells (three sets × 12–15 reps). The Senior Fitness Test (SFT), the Single Leg Stance test (SLS) and the Short Falls Efficacy Scale-International (FES-I) were assessed before and after the intervention. Results Results showed that after training, either in normoxia or in hypoxia, the participants increased upper and lower body strength, and the aerobic endurance, and decreased the fear of falling. Conclusions The moderate hypoxic conditioning seems to be a useful tool to increase the functional capacity in healthy older adults without observing a decline in balance. Abstract Background The aim of this study was to investigate the effect of 12 weeks of aerobic training, 4 weeks of detraining and use gonadotropin-releasing hormone agonist (GnRHa) on serum C-reactive protein (CRP) and cortisol levels in girls with central precocious puberty (CPP). Methods Forty-five girls (aged 6–8 years) with precocious puberty were randomly divided into three groups (medication, training and medicine + training groups). Fifteen healthy girls (without precocious puberty) were also included as the control group. Serum CRP and cortisol levels were measured at baseline by the enzyme-linked immunosorbent assay (ELISA) technique. Then, the experimental groups performed an aerobic training program for 3 days/week 20–75 min per day at 45–75% maximum heart rate for 12 weeks. The medication groups also received GnRHa during the study, once a month (1 mL every 4 weeks) by intramuscular injection. Serum CRP and cortisol levels were measured again 48 h after the last training session and also after 4 weeks of detraining. Results Analysis of variance (ANOVA) with repeated measures showed a significant decrease in CRP (p = 0.02) and cortisol levels (p = 0.01) in the training group and the medicine + training group. Detraining led to return of CRP and cortisol levels to the pre-training levels (p = 0.001). No significant difference in serum CRP (p = 0.43) and cortisol levels (p = 0.06) was observed in the medication group. Further, no significant difference was observed between groups in CRP and cortisol. Conclusions Long-term regular moderate training decreases inflammation indices, and detraining eliminates the benefits of training in girls with precocious puberty.

We conducted a multicentre, randomized controlled trial with blinded outcome assessment. The treatment period was 6 weeks with follow-up assessment immediately thereafter and after 6 months. The objective was to determine the effectiveness of a craniocervical training programme combined with physiotherapy for tension-type headache. Eighty-one participants meeting the diagnostic criteria for tension-type headache were randomly assigned to an exercise group (physiotherapy and an additional craniocervical training programme) and a control group (physiotherapy alone). The primary outcome measure was headache frequency. Secondary outcomes included headache intensity and duration, Quality of Life (SF-36) and the Multidimensional Headache Locus of Control scale (MHLC). At 6 months' follow-up, the craniocervical training group showed significantly reduced headache frequency, intensity and duration ( P < 0.001 for all). Effect sizes were large and clinically relevant. Loss to follow-up amounted to 3.7±. Physiotherapy including craniocervical training reduces symptoms of tension-type headache significantly over a prolonged time frame.

AbstractFocusing on symptoms of attention deficit hyperactivity disorder (ADHD) in a sample obtained from the general population, we aimed to investigate the effects of incentives and event rate on reaction time (RT) performance and response inhibition. We assessed 1156 children, at a mean age of 8 years, on their performance on an inhibition task and a RT task under different experimental conditions that manipulated event rate and incentives. Children with high ADHD (ADHD-H) symptoms showed cognitive performance deficits only under some of the experimental conditions compared to a control group. The fast-incentive condition of the RT task succeeded in normalizing the RT variability, as well as the slow overall speed, in the ADHD-H group. Analyses of ADHD symptom scores as a quantitative trait in the total sample were overall consistent with these findings. The findings suggest that at least some cognitive performance deficits in children with high ADHD symptoms do not reflect stable cognitive deficits. The degree to which cognitive impairments in ADHD can be modulated by energetic or motivational factors has important implications for clinical and educational interventions. The effect of exercise on cognitive performance in an older population was studied. Thirty sedentary men and women 65–72 years of age were randomly assigned to a walking group, a weight training group, or a placebo control group. Intervention groups exercised 30–60 min 5 days per week for 16 weeks, with the walking group training at 60% heart rate reserve, the weight training group employing the DAPRE method of weight progression, and the placebo control group engaging in mild range-of-motion and flexibility movements that kept their heart rates close to resting levels. At baseline and 16 weeks posttraining each subject completed the Ross Information Processing Assessment (RIPA), a maximal graded treadmill test, and a strength assessment of the knee extensors and elbow flexors. Sixteen weeks of walking improved VO2peak of the sedentary subjects 15.8%; VO2peak did not improve in the other two groups. Additionally, the RIPA scores of the walking group increased 7.5%, while those of the weight-training and control groups showed little change.

Both functional and traditional resistance training increase muscular fitness. This study aims at highlighting the benefits of functional training compared to traditional training. Thus, we analyze the effects of functional training on muscular fitness in terms of endurance, agility, strength, flexibility and balance. A group of 40 martial arts practitioners, aged 18-30 years, was divided in a functional training experimental group (n = 20) and a traditional resistance control group (n = 20). Anthropometric measures were done to the test group of martial arts practitioners which were tested before and after the training study period of 7 weeks. The results showed an important improvement (p < 0.05) in endurance, push-ups, 1-RM bench press and squat, one-leg balance and back extension. Functional training group had a significant increase in flexibility and shoulder girth (p < 0.05). The main difference comparing the two test groups was in flexion time and forearm girth. In conclusion, functional training increases endurance, shoulder girth and flexibility

Common infectious diseases, such as diarrhea, are still the major cause of death in children under 5-years-old, particularly in developing countries. It is known that there is a close relationship between nutrition and immune function. To evaluate the effect of a growing-up milk containing synbiotics on immune function and child growth, we conducted a cluster randomized, multicenter, double-blind, placebo controlled clinical trial in children between 18 and 36 months of age in Vietnam. Eligible children from eight and seven kindergartens were randomly assigned to receive test and isocaloric/isoproteic control milk, respectively, for 5 months. We found that the blood immunoglobulin A (IgA) level and growth parameters were increased in the test group. Compared to the control group, there was also a trend of decreased vitamin A deficiency and fewer adverse events in the test group. These data suggest that a growing-up milk containing synbiotics may be useful in supporting immune function and promoting growth in children.

Aim: To evaluate the effect on vertical bone augmentation of the screw tent-pole technique using particulate allograft in combination with injectable platelet-rich fibrin, and to compare this with autogenous block bone graft. Materials and Methods: This split-mouth randomized controlled study involved patients with bilateral partial edentulism and vertical bone loss in the posterior mandible. In each patient, the control side was treated with autogenous block bone graft harvested from the mandibular ramus and, on the test side, the screw tent-pole technique was employed, using particulate allograft in combination with injectable platelet-rich fibrin. All augmented sites were covered by leukocyte and platelet-rich fibrin membrane. The primary outcome variable of this study was the radiographic changes to bone height 6 months after augmentation. The secondary outcome variables were the percentage of newly formed bone and the implant survival rate. The data were analyzed with a significance level of α = 0.05. Results: Of the 13 patients included, a total of 11 patients (7 females, 4 males; mean age 50.92) completed the study. The mean values of vertical bone gain were 1.72 ± 0.78 mm for the test group and 2.83 ± 0.89 mm for the control group, which constitutes a significant difference ( P = .008). The percentage of newly formed bone was 18.08% ± 2.17% for the test group and 14.26% ± 1.76% for the control group. The difference between the groups was statistically significant ( P < .001). The implant survival rates were 100% for both study groups. Conclusions: Based on the study results, screw tent-pole can be considered a feasible technique for bone augmentation. Further randomized studies will be necessary to fully evaluate vertical bone augmentation using the screw tent-pole technique, with different graft materials and with larger samples.

Abstract Chronic periodontitis (CP) and Diabetes mellitus type 2 (DMII) are chronic diseases usually treated by conventional practices. On the other hand, homeopathy can help to treat many different diseases. The aim of this study was to evaluate the effects of homeopathy (H) as an adjunct for non-surgical periodontal therapy (NSPT) in individuals with DMII and CP. Eighty individuals with CP and DM II, of both sexes and aged between 32 and 70 years, participated in this randomized, double-blind, placebo-controlled study. They were divided into two groups: control group (CG) and the test group (TG), and both groups received the NSPT. TG also received homeopathic therapy, including Berberis, Mercurius solubilis/Belladonna/Hepar sulphur and Pyrogenium, while CG received placebo. Clinical and laboratorial examinations were evaluated at baseline and after 1, 6 and 12 months of treatment. Both groups showed significant improvement throughout the study, for most of the parameters studied, but TG presented significative gain of CAL at 1 and 12 months compared to CG. Mean glucose and glycated hemoglobin significantly decreased in both groups after 6 and 12 months. However, there was a significantly further reduction of these parameters in TG, as compared to CG. In conclusion, homeopathy as supplement of NSPT may further improve health condition, including glycemic control, in DMII patients with CP.

In peri-implantitis, treatment lasers are effectively used to enhance implant surfaces’ decontamination of bacteria. The type of lasers commonly used and tested in dentistry are Nd:YAG, Er:YAG and diodes. The Er:YAG laser is considered to be effective in removing biofilm from implant surfaces. Photodynamic therapy (PDT), realized with low-level laser therapy (LLLT) and a photosensitizer, seems to have limited efficacy in peri-implantitis management, while diode lasers used with high frequency and power (Wiser, Doctor Smile), performed with hydrogen peroxide 10 vol. 3% (OHLLT), seems to lead to a deep sanitization of implant surfaces, without any thermal effect. The aim of our retrospective controlled study is to compare an oxygen high-level laser therapy (OHLLT) protocol with OHLLT with an Er:YAG laser (Pluser, Doctor Smile) in order to maximize bacterial removal and to evaluate if an Er:YAG laser could improve hard tissue regeneration with respect to OHLLT alone. Two hundred and ten implants affected by peri-implantitis were divided into two groups: 88 implants were treated with OHLLT alone (control group) while 122 underwent OHLLT and Er:YAG treatment (test group). Mean bone loss before (T0) and after treatment (T1) (with a follow-up of 5 years) was registered for all implants. The collected data were analyzed with the Statistical Package for Social Sciences (SPSS) version 11.5. No statistically significant differences were found. In the OHLLT group, we noticed a mean bone loss after treatment of 2.1 mm in the upper arch and 2.4 mm in the mandible. In the OHLLT + Er:YAG group, the results indicate a mean bone loss of 2.0 mm in the upper arch and 2.5 mm in the mandible. Both groups showed a mean bone loss after treatment of 2.3 mm. According to the Kolmogorov–Smirnov test, overall, data followed a normal distribution (value of the K-S test statistic = 0.0912; p = 0.36112). OHLLT plays a central role in enhancing clinical results in peri-implantitis treatment, leading to an effective bacterial decontamination. Our results showed no statistically significant differences between OHLLT and OHLLT + Er:YAG laser; thus, the potential advantageous role of Er:YAG has been downgraded with the analysis of our study.
